Hi...I will be taking my sengelese twists down on Friday and needed some help from you guys concerning 'MATTING'...Are there any suggestions? Have you ever had braids or twists and your hair matted after you wet your hair? If so, how did you handle it? Should I just let conditioner sit in my hair(braid) as I take the braid out? :ohwell: I need help ladies :) Thanks in advance...
 
I would suggest getting some braid removal spray and drench your hair with it as you take the braids out. That will help with some of the buildup.

Also make sure to comb your hair and do an ACV rinse or use some other kind of clarifier to remove the buildup. Do this BEFORE shampooing so your hair doesn't mat up.

I always had matting, I know how you feel! I was the one with braids in my hair for like 4 months, lol. I cosign with CandiceC about drenching with detangling spray. I had to use a toothpick to take mine down because a comb wouldn't do it. I detangled each hair strand by strand. Most importantly, give yourself a lot of TIME. It's painstakingly slow. I'm talkin' anywhere from a day to 2 days. Speeding up is what causes you to lose a lot of hair.
